About Kalibo International Airport
Kalibo International Airport is an international airport that serves the general area of Kalibo, the capital of the province of Aklan in the Philippines, and is one of two airports serving Boracay, the other being Godofredo P. Ramos Airport in the municipality of Malay. It is situated 2 kilometers (1.2 mi) east of the town proper of Kalibo and 68 kilometers (42 mi) southwest from Caticlan port in Malay. It is one of the two classified international airports on the island of Panay, alongside Iloilo International Airport, and is among the busiest airports in Western Visayas.

Runways (1)
| Runway | Length | Width | Surface | Lighting | Status |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 05 / 23 | 7,175 ft / 2,187 m | 148 ft | Con | Lighted | Open |
Radio frequencies (2)
| Type | Description | Frequency |
|---|---|---|
| APCH | Kalibo Approach | 123.100 MHz |
| TWR | Kalibo Tower | 124.200 MHz |

Airspace in this area(5)
| Name | Class | Type | Floor | Ceiling |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| KALIBO | Class B | ATZ | GND | 2000 ft MSL |
| KALIBO | Class D | TMA | 1500 ft MSL | FL200 |
| KALIBO | Class D | CTR | GND | 1500 ft MSL |
| RPHI FIR | Special use | FIR | GND | FL999 |
| PHILIPPINE AIR DEFENSE IDENTIFICATION ZONE (PADIZ) | Special use | ADIZ | GND | FL999 |

Frequently asked questions
What is the ICAO code for Kalibo International Airport?
The ICAO code for Kalibo International Airport is RPVK, and its IATA code is KLO.
Where is Kalibo International Airport located?
Kalibo International Airport is large airport located in Kalibo, Philippines, at an elevation of 14 ft (4 m).
How many runways does Kalibo International Airport have?
Kalibo International Airport has 1 runway, the longest being 7,175 ft / 2,187 m.
Which airlines fly to Kalibo International Airport?
Airlines historically serving Kalibo International Airport include Air Philippines, AirAsia, Cebu Pacific, LSM Airlines, Philippine Airlines, South East Asian Airlines, among 8 carriers (based on OpenFlights route data, which may be out of date).
How many destinations are served from Kalibo International Airport?
Historical data lists 8 nonstop destinations from Kalibo International Airport. Always check current schedules.
What time zone is Kalibo International Airport in?
Kalibo International Airport is in the Asia/Manila time zone (UTC+08:00).
What is the magnetic variation at Kalibo International Airport?
The magnetic variation (declination) at Kalibo International Airport is approximately 2.3° W, per the World Magnetic Model. Variation changes slowly over time — always use the current value charted for navigation.
What airports are near Kalibo International Airport?
The nearest airport to Kalibo International Airport is Roxas Airport (RXS), about 22.6 nm to the ese, followed by Godofredo P. Ramos Airport and Azagra Airstrip.
